If the item has been made from silver or another low-value metal and is set with semi-precious stones (such as agate, amethyst, … Webb27 nov. 2024 · The word provenance has its origins in the French word provenir, meaning “to come from”. An ideal provenance captures the ownership history of a piece all the way back to its initial creation. elliot hospital visiting hours
